Tiger Men and Women Third at Cardinal Invitational
San Antonio - Trinity's men's and women's swimming & diving teams both finished third at the Cardinal Invitational, which concluded on Saturday evening.
Trinity faced off against Division I and Division II competition in the meet, which was hosted by the University of Incarnate Word (at Palo Alto College).
In Saturday's final day of competition, the Tigers had 18 swimmers and divers finish in the top five in their respective events.
The diving competition saw the most success for Trinity, as the Tiger women's divers finished in the top three spots in the one-meter event, led by Katie Sheldon's first-place finish. Ruth Hahn and Lynne Bettinger were second and third. On the three-meter board, Hahn was second, followed by Sheldon and Bettinger in fifth and sixth, respectively.
Men's divers Richard Hawley and Kevin Martin were fourth and fifth in the three-meter competition, while Martin bounced back with a second-place finish on the one-meter board.
In the women's swimming competition, Melanie Gustafson, Sarah Miller, and Lisa Tucci took second, third, and fifth in the 400 individual medley, while Kelly Holton was fourth in the 100 breaststroke. Jennifer Ince was fifth in the 200 backstroke.
For the men, Trinity's 800 freestyle relay team finished second. The relay team was composed of Alex Miranda, Matthew Wey, CJ Robison, and JJ Lubinski. Sean Fronczak was fifth in the 100 backstroke, and Andrew Battles was fourth in the 200 back. In addition to leading off the 800 free relay for the Tigers, Miranda also finished fourth in the 1650 freestyle, while teammate Lucas Belury earned third in the mile-long race.
Trinity's men's and women's teams will next compete at the 2012 SCAC Championships in Rockwall, Texas. The women will be looking for their ninth consecutive conference title, while the men will be seeking their first since 2004.
